The realm of industrial automation features a handful of global giants who consistently push the boundaries of production. Among these, Siemens, Allen-Bradley, ABB, and Schneider Electric stand out as dominant forces, each with a rich history of pioneering.
- Siemens, a German multinational, is renowned for its wide-ranging portfolio of automation solutions, spanning from robotics and drives to PLCs and SCADA systems.
- Allen-Bradley, an American subsidiary of Rockwell Automation, is a benchmark in the field of industrial controls, particularly for its renowned programmable logic controllers (PLCs) and HMI (Human Machine Interface) solutions.
- ABB, a Swedish-Swiss multinational, focuses on robotics, drives, motors, and automation. Its extensive product range is widely used in industries like manufacturing, energy, and infrastructure
- Schneider Electric, a French multinational, is a leader in energy management and automation. Its portfolio includes switches, circuit breakers, power distribution equipment, and software solutions for industrial control and monitoring.
